Transaction 07667e9940798360cb1e0ea4aa5dc37bbbd1613bc20ae112e4a7eb03c1de96d5

1 Input
1 Outputs
  • 07667e9940798360cb1e0ea4aa5dc37bbbd1613bc20ae112e4a7eb03c1de96d5:0
  • value  979864962
    address  1Jbe51AX2TcnKGvqyM67GgGkZkuznXDvHC